Batteries use chemicals to store energy, while capacitors use electric fields. while batteries and capacitors have similarities, there are several key differences. the main difference between a battery and a capacitor is that battery stores charge in the form of chemical energy and convert to the electrical energy whereas, capacitor stores charge in the form of electrostatic field.
